--- a/src/wl/sys/wl_cfg80211_hybrid.h
+++ b/src/wl/sys/wl_cfg80211_hybrid.h
@@ -119,7 +119,7 @@
 struct wl_cfg80211_event_loop {
 	s32(*handler[WLC_E_LAST]) (struct wl_cfg80211_priv *wl, struct net_device *ndev,
 	                           const wl_event_msg_t *e, void *data);
-};
+} __no_const;
 
 struct wl_cfg80211_bss_info {
 	u16 band;
